How Do Multi-Cavity Sow molds Improve Aluminum Casting Productivity?
In modern aluminium plants, productivity rests on how well the molten aluminium is handled, how safely the pouring process is done, and how well the equipment works. A multi-cavity sow mold lets workers pour more than one aluminium sow in a structured way, which helps them get more done than with standard single-cavity solutions. A sow mold is mostly used to make big aluminium sows that are then sold and taken to other primary or secondary aluminium plants to be worked on further. These big sows usually come in standard weight ranges, like 1200 lb, 1500 lb, and 2000 lb. Sow molds are heavy-duty containers for big aluminium blocks, while ingot molds are made for smaller aluminium ingots that weigh a few kilograms to a few tens of kilograms.
Aluminium recovery rate is not the most important thing about a sow mold. Aluminium recovery is mostly about getting aluminium out of aluminium dross that has been recycled. Instead, sow molds help the next step after preparing the molten aluminium by giving a reliable place to shape the aluminium products into shapes that can be handled. The aluminium sows that are made are usually remelted again in later steps, so exact sizes are not as important as making sure the structure is stable, the sows are easy to handle, and they last a long time.

Why Does Sow mold Design and Material Quality Matter for Long-Term Aluminum Plant Operations?
The performance of a sow mold depends heavily on design quality and material selection. During aluminum melting and pouring operations, molds experience thermal shocks and mechanical stress. For this reason, aluminum plants require equipment that can maintain structural integrity over long operating cycles. Quality control is also a key factor in extending service life. Unlike ordinary products, Xian Huan-Tai sow molds and ingot molds undergo Non-Destructive Testing (NDT) to identify surface and subsurface discontinuities in areas exposed to molten aluminum. This process helps ensure that products meet demanding industrial requirements. For extreme operating conditions, including applications involving water cooling, specially developed steel grades can reduce the risk of cracking.
Different sow mold designs are available based on customer needs. For example, high profile sow mold and low profile sow mold options mainly represent differences in mold height and configuration. The selection depends on production requirements, transportation methods, and workplace preferences rather than differences in aluminum quality or casting speed. Forklift holes can also be integrated into mold designs to improve transportation safety, simplify handling, and reduce risks during material movement.
